Respondent No. 1 on the one hand had to migrate due to turmoil the valley is going through and on the other he is deprived of his proprietary rights by Naib Tehsildar Buchhwara by sheer stroke of his pen without hearing him, obviously, the old adage `misfortunes never come alone is aptly attracted traceable to order of mutation dated 28-06-1992 passed against a dead person namely Pandit Prem Nath Jalali favoring another dead person namely Sidiq Bhat one of the beneficiaries of the mutation. Being aggrieved, the order came to be challenged before the Financial Commissioner which was resisted on the ground of being barred by limitation but the objection could not sustain, consequently turned down by order dated 13-08-2003. It is the said order which is impugned by medium of this writ petition contending that appeal has to abate, for, some of the tenants were dead on the date of institution of appeal.
